GDC Technology has introduced the SR-5400 and the SR-6400 series media servers with Flexible Architecture Stable Technology (FAST) for 4K high frame rate movies and 4K 3D. The SR-5400 is compatible with new DLP Cinema projectors that are capable of playing DCP content in 4K 3D and [email protected] The SR-6400C has all the key features and benefits of the SR-5400 and further enhances its capabilities to include ground breaking [email protected] playback. It is compatible with the new Christie projector featuring RealLaser illumination and CineLife+.

Samsung Electronics unveiled its largest-ever 3D-ready Onyx screen at Capital Cinema in the Xicheng district in Beijing, China. The December 7 opening of the world’s largest 3D LED cinema was timed with the premiere of Warner Bros.’ DC Comics superhero film Aquaman, which has a DTS:X immersive sound track. Aquaman opened with $93.6 million in ticket sales in three days in China, marking the best start for a Warner Bros. title in that territory.

Volfoni has been granted Russian patent number RU2669544C2 for its triple-beam technology, which underlies the company’s SmartCrystal Diamond passive three dimensional cinema product. This patent had already previously been granted in both the USA and China. The extension in Russia ensures that Volfoni’s technologies are fully protected around the world.

Volfoni has been granted patent number 10,151,932 in the U.S. territory for its three dimensional elliptical polarization. Previous third-party cinema systems for 3D have required the use of passive 3D glasses based on either circular or linear polarization. Volfoni’s innovation instead uses passive 3D glasses based on elliptical polarization. According to the company, this not only improves the overall light efficiency and performance, but also avoids a host of other third-party choices, which specifically mandate the use of circular polarization.

The Open Geospatial Consortium and the Khronos Group are joining forces to advance open geospatial standards related to the fields of augmented and virtual reality, distributed simulation, and 3D content services. As part of the liaison, and through collaborative participation in OGC and Khronos initiatives, the two organizations will work jointly to develop use cases and requirements for open geospatial standards concerning 3D, virtual and augmented reality APIs, and related graphical representations.

Vox Cinemas has selected Volfoni for their 3D hardware systems for the first multiplex at Riyadh Park in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. Vox Cinemas was awarded one of the first licenses to operate cinemas in Saudi Arabia and their multiplex at Riyadh Park is the first of its kind in the kingdom.
